! Job Summary The Director of Dining Services, reporting directly to the VP of Operations, holds duties related to day-to-day operations of a designated client account. This hands-on position entails a need for excellent communication and client relationship building skills and strong operational leadership with expertise in catering and cafe management.
This position offers a desirable Monday through Friday schedule (some evenings required). You will work alongside a salaried culinary manager and oversee a small hourly staff.
Key Responsibilities: Manages day to day operations of an account Maintains excellent relationships with customers, guests and client as well as other departments Oversees financials as it pertains to the account Conducts HR functions including hiring, progressive counseling, terminations Oversees scheduling, payroll and team training
Preferred Qualifications: A minimum of three years of foodservice operation experience Previous experience managing financials including budgets and weekly reporting Strong knowledge of Microsoft programs Desire to learn and grow with a top notch foodservice company Associates at Restaurant Associates are offered many fantastic benefits.
